links in Epiphany not working


Ok I've been using Epiphany for a little while now without any problems. however I suspect that Uni recently upgraded the version they use because I've had to redo the proxy settings and clicking on links no longer works. If you click on a link or a button the browser does nothing. you can right click on a link and select "open link" and that works, but it doesn't work for buttons. Which makes it difficult to login, search etc etc.
